ADEAMctRNA-specific and double-stranded RNA adenosine deaminase (RNA-specific editase) | |

| InterPro abstract: | Editase ( EC:3.5 ) are enzymes that alter mRNA by catalyzing thesite-selective deamination of adenosine residue into inosine residue.The editase domain contains the active site and binds three Zn atoms [ PUBMED:9159072 ]. Several editases share a … expand |
| GO process: | RNA processing (GO:0006396) |
| GO function: | adenosine deaminase activity (GO:0004000), RNA binding (GO:0003723) |
